Baccarat AsiaSpa Award winners announced
POSTED 24 Nov 2006 . BY Sarah Todd
The winners of the 2006 Baccarat AsiaSpa Awards have been revealed.

The majority of Asia’s spa destinations won an award, including properties in India, Thailand, Indonesia, The Philippines, The Maldives, China, Malaysia and Hong Kong.

The Farm at San Benito, Philippines triumphed in two categories, winning the Medi-Spa of the Year and Spa Cuisine of the Year.

Four Seasons Resorts and Spas won both Exterior Design of the Year for its resort in Langkawi and the Marketing of the Year award, while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ts scooped the Spa Treatment of the Year for its Himalayan Healing Stone Massage and Interior Design of the Year for the Shangri-La Pudong spa in China.

The In-Spa Training of the Year award went to the Mandarin Oriental Hotel Group while New Spa of the Year went to the JW Marriott Hotel’s Quan Spa in Mumbai, India.

Kirana Spa in Bali won Day Spa of the Year and the Maldives was named Spa Capital of the Year.

Other winners included Ananda in the Himalayas, India, which won Destination Spa of the Year and Spa Association of the Year was Asia Pacific Spa and Wellness Council. ISPA Asia in Bangkok, Thailand, collected Spa Event of the Year.

A panel of 26 Asia-based spa experts were responsible for nominating the spas and resorts for this year’s awards. Details: www.adkom.com
